Development of clinically relevant in vivo metastasis models using human bone discs and breast cancer patient-derived xenografts.

Diane LefleyFaith HowardFawaz ArshadSteven BradburyHannah BrownClaudia TulottaRachel EyreDenis AlférezJ Mark WilkinsonIngunn HolenRobert B ClarkePenelope D Ottewell
Published in: Breast cancer research : BCR (2019)
Our reliable and clinically relevant humanised mouse models provide significant advancements in modelling of breast cancer bone metastasis.
